What are the best practices for implementing symmetric versus asymmetric encryption in digital currency wallets?
Đào Văn MongOct 09, 2022 · 3 years ago3 answers
What are some recommended methods for implementing symmetric and asymmetric encryption in digital currency wallets to ensure the security of user funds?
3 answers
- Transgenie marketingOct 13, 2021 · 4 years agoOne of the best practices for implementing encryption in digital currency wallets is to use a combination of symmetric and asymmetric encryption. Symmetric encryption is faster and more efficient for encrypting large amounts of data, while asymmetric encryption provides stronger security for key exchange and authentication. By using both types of encryption, digital currency wallets can achieve a balance between security and performance. Another important practice is to use strong encryption algorithms and key lengths. Popular choices for symmetric encryption include AES-256 and Twofish, while RSA and Elliptic Curve Cryptography (ECC) are commonly used for asymmetric encryption. It's also crucial to regularly update the encryption algorithms and key lengths to stay ahead of potential vulnerabilities. Additionally, implementing secure key management practices is essential. This includes generating and storing encryption keys securely, using hardware security modules (HSMs) for key storage, and regularly rotating keys to minimize the impact of a potential compromise. Overall, the best practices for implementing symmetric and asymmetric encryption in digital currency wallets involve a combination of encryption types, strong encryption algorithms and key lengths, and secure key management practices.
- Rajiya NaMar 26, 2021 · 5 years agoWhen it comes to implementing encryption in digital currency wallets, there are a few best practices to keep in mind. First, it's important to understand the difference between symmetric and asymmetric encryption. Symmetric encryption uses a single key for both encryption and decryption, while asymmetric encryption uses a pair of keys - a public key for encryption and a private key for decryption. One recommended method is to use symmetric encryption for encrypting the actual data stored in the wallet, such as private keys and transaction details. This provides fast and efficient encryption and decryption processes. Asymmetric encryption, on the other hand, can be used for key exchange and authentication purposes, ensuring secure communication between the wallet and other entities. Another best practice is to use strong encryption algorithms and key lengths. This helps to ensure the security of the encrypted data. Popular choices for symmetric encryption include AES-256 and Twofish, while RSA and ECC are commonly used for asymmetric encryption. Lastly, it's crucial to implement secure key management practices. This includes generating and storing encryption keys securely, regularly updating encryption algorithms and key lengths, and using hardware security modules (HSMs) for key storage. By following these best practices, digital currency wallets can enhance the security of user funds and protect against potential threats.
- Lancaster MohammadApr 04, 2024 · 2 years agoAt BYDFi, we believe that the best practices for implementing symmetric and asymmetric encryption in digital currency wallets involve a combination of both encryption types. Symmetric encryption is faster and more efficient for encrypting large amounts of data, while asymmetric encryption provides stronger security for key exchange and authentication. To ensure the security of user funds, it is recommended to use symmetric encryption for encrypting the actual data stored in the wallet, such as private keys and transaction details. Asymmetric encryption can be used for key exchange and authentication purposes, ensuring secure communication between the wallet and other entities. In addition to encryption types, it is important to use strong encryption algorithms and key lengths. Popular choices for symmetric encryption include AES-256 and Twofish, while RSA and ECC are commonly used for asymmetric encryption. Regularly updating encryption algorithms and key lengths is also crucial to stay ahead of potential vulnerabilities. Furthermore, implementing secure key management practices is essential. This includes generating and storing encryption keys securely, regularly rotating keys, and using hardware security modules (HSMs) for key storage. By following these best practices, digital currency wallets can provide users with a secure and reliable platform for storing and transacting cryptocurrencies.
Top Picks
- How to Use Bappam TV to Watch Telugu, Tamil, and Hindi Movies?1 4434566
- ISO 20022 Coins: What They Are, Which Cryptos Qualify, and Why It Matters for Global Finance0 110858
- How to Withdraw Money from Binance to a Bank Account in the UAE?3 010179
- The Best DeFi Yield Farming Aggregators: A Trader's Guide0 09938
- Bitcoin Dominance Chart: Your Guide to Crypto Market Trends in 20250 26051
- How to Make Real Money with X: From Digital Wallets to Elon Musk’s X App0 15885
相關標籤
今日熱門
Trade, Compete, Win — BYDFi’s 6th Anniversary Campaign
The Hidden Engine Powering Your Crypto Trades
Trump Coin in 2026: New Insights for Crypto Enthusiasts
Japan Enters Bitcoin Mining — Progress or Threat to Decentralization?
Is Dogecoin Ready for Another Big Move in Crypto?
BlockDAG News: Presale Deadline, Remaining Supply & Market Trends
Is Nvidia the King of AI Stocks in 2026?
AMM (Automated Market Maker): What It Is & How It Works in DeFi
Is Bitcoin Nearing Its 2025 Peak? Analyzing Post-Halving Price Trends
Crypto Mining Rig: What It Is and How It Powers Proof‑of‑Work Networks
更多
熱門問題
- 3313
What is the current spot price of alumina in the cryptocurrency market?
- 2960
What are some popular monster legends code for cryptocurrency enthusiasts?
- 2742
How do blockchain wallet reviews help in choosing the right wallet for cryptocurrencies?
- 2716
What are the best psychedelic companies to invest in the crypto market?
- 2693
What is the current exchange rate for European dollars to USD?
- 1466
What are the advantages of trading digital currencies on Forex Capital Markets Limited?
- 1359
What are the best MT4 programming resources for developing cryptocurrency trading indicators?
- 1358
What are the system requirements for installing the Deriv MT5 desktop platform for cryptocurrency trading?
更多優質問答